Transaction 5fd8d16ef129c21c111280ef6685fc6d56c021b5bfefd546a3157c32fc550d4a

1 Input
2 Outputs
  • 5fd8d16ef129c21c111280ef6685fc6d56c021b5bfefd546a3157c32fc550d4a:0
  • value  17733546
    address  3EULjzePPRTFh2ck17umD7gMaHDS1zYpbL
  • 5fd8d16ef129c21c111280ef6685fc6d56c021b5bfefd546a3157c32fc550d4a:1
  • value  109335
    address  3H6BHdtm7uff4L7ZrPxrrAisdyA4hDMUmT